#0b3899 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0b3899 is composed of 4.3% red, 22%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.8% cyan, 63.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 221 degrees, a saturation of 86.6% and a lightness of 32.2%. #0b3899 color hex could be obtained by blending #1670ff with #000033.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#0b3899 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0b3899 has RGB values of R:11, G:56, B:153 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 735385.

Shades and Tints of #0b3899
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000207 is the darkest color, while #f3f7fe is the lightest one.
